ubuntu

Ubuntu AppImage如何进行调试优化

小樊
42
2025-09-07 05:03:26
栏目: 智能运维

Ubuntu AppImage调试优化方法

  1. 基础配置优化

    • 赋予可执行权限:确保AppImage文件可执行,命令:chmod +x example.AppImage
    • 安装依赖库:安装FUSE库(AppImage运行必需),命令:sudo apt update && sudo apt install libfuse2
  2. 启动性能优化

    • 使用运行参数:通过--appimage-extract-and-run参数启动,可加快加载速度,命令:./example.AppImage --appimage-extract-and-run
    • 禁用非必要启动项:通过systemd-analyze blame分析耗时服务,禁用冗余服务(如sudo systemctl disable service_name)。
    • 优化系统设置:更新系统、使用SSD硬盘、清理系统垃圾文件,减少启动资源占用。
  3. 日志与错误排查

    • 查看系统日志:通过journalctl -u YourApp查看AppImage相关日志(需应用支持systemd服务)。
    • 重定向输出日志:运行时重定向输出到文件,如./example.AppImage > app.log 2>&1,便于分析错误。
    • 检查应用文档:部分AppImage可能提供自定义日志路径或调试模式,需参考官方说明。
  4. 集成与便捷性优化

    • 集成到系统菜单:安装AppImageLauncher工具,自动添加应用到Ubuntu菜单,方便管理。
    • 创建桌面快捷方式:手动编写.desktop文件(放置于~/.local/share/applications/),添加图标和启动路径。

注意:优化前建议备份重要数据,部分操作(如修改系统配置)需谨慎。若问题持续,可尝试重新下载AppImage或联系开发者获取支持。

0
看了该问题的人还看了